2025 - 2026 LEGISLATURE LRB-6107/1 MDE:cjs 2025 ASSEMBLY BILL 907 January 26, 2026 - Introduced by Representatives Piwowarczyk, Bare, Knodl, O'Connor, Penterman, Steffen, Armstrong, Dittrich and Murphy, cosponsored by Senator Tomczyk. Referred to Committee on Consumer Protection. An Act to repeal 565.27 (2) (b) 1. and 565.27 (2) (b) 4.; to create 565.27 (2) (b) 1m. and 565.27 (2) (b) 4m. of the statutes; relating to: requirements for state lottery drawings. Analysis by the Legislative Reference Bureau Under current law, among other requirements, drawings for the state lottery must be witnessed by an independent certified public accountant, and any equipment used for the drawing must generally be inspected by an independent certified public accountant and a Department of Revenue employee before and after the drawing. This bill repeals the above requirements for drawings of the state lottery and creates the following requirements: 1. The drawings must be random selections of the winning results. DOR may employ mechanical, electrical, or computerized drawing methods to make the selections. 2. At least annually, for any drawings conducted, DOR must contract with an independent firm to perform an audit of the drawing processes and review technologies employed by DOR, security procedures, computer and systems security, and randomly selected drawings. The people of the state of Wisconsin, represented in senate and assembly, do enact as follows: Section 1. 565.27 (2) (b) 1. of the statutes is repealed. Section 2. 565.27 (2) (b) 1m. of the statutes is created to read: 565.27 (2) (b) 1m. The drawings shall be random selections of the winning results. The department may employ mechanical, electrical, or computerized drawing methods to make the selections. Section 3. 565.27 (2) (b) 4. of the statutes is repealed. Section 4. 565.27 (2) (b) 4m. of the statutes is created to read: 565.27 (2) (b) 4m. At least annually, for any drawings conducted, the department shall contract with an independent firm to perform an audit of the drawing processes and review technologies employed by the department, security procedures, computer and systems security, and randomly selected drawings.
